Abstract

1,176,688. Brazing. BORG-WARNER CORP. 9 Feb., 1967 [14 March, 1966], No. 6308/67. Heading B3R. [Also in Division C7] In bonding two aluminium and/or aluminium alloy parts an aluminium-silicon brazing alloy and a bond-promoting metal selected from nickel, cobalt, iron, arsenic and silver are provided between the parts, the parts are arranged in a protective atmosphere, the temperature of the parts is increased so that a fused bonding material having as its constituents the brazing alloy and bond-promoting metal bonds together the parts, the temperature of the parts is reduced to about 100‹ F. below the melting point of the bonding material, and the parts are removed from the protective atmosphere at this temperature. An aluminium alloy (at least 99%) heat exchanger comprising fins, tubes and headers is bonded by using aluminium-10% silicon alloy shim stock coated with nickel. Shims are placed around tubes fitted in holes in the headers and at other surfaces to be joined and the assembly is heated in a nitrogen furnace to 1000‹ F. within ten minutes and to 1100‹ F. in 1¢ minutes. The assembly is held at 1100‹ F. for ¢ minute, the heater being then turned off and the assembly cooled to 1000‹ F. within two minutes and removed. In another example a heat exchanger comprises aluminium alloy (1À2% mg.) tubes clad externally with aluminium-10% silicon alloy, the same aluminium alloy headers clad on both sides with the aluminium-silicon alloy and pins of aluminium alloy (at least 99%) without cladding. The tubes and headers are electroless plated with nickel and the parts are assembled and heated in nitrogen to the same temperatures as before. The bond-promoting metal maybe included in the bonding alloy and the protective atmosphere may be of argon, helium, hydrogen or vacuum. The bond-promoting metal may be applied as a coating deposited by vacuum or thermal deposition.
